Detailed explanation-1: -The Battle of Tippecanoe, upon which Harrison’s fame was to rest, disrupted Tecumseh’s confederacy but failed to diminish Indian raids. By the spring of 1812, they were again terrorizing the frontier.
Detailed explanation-2: -In one of the greatest battles of the War of 1812, Harrison defeated the Shawnee-British alliance in the Battle of the Thames. Harrison’s old enemy, Tecumseh, died during the fight. With the victory, the United States forever shattered the Northwest Indian Confederation and dealt the British an embarrassing blow.
